According to the Federal Highway Administration's 2024 National Bridge Inventory, Cass County ranks #10 of 92 Indiana counties with at least 5 public highway bridges on Poor-condition share (lower share ranks better; currently 1.6%). Cass County, Indiana contains 185 public highway bridges. Roughly 48.6% are rated “Good,” 49.7% “Fair,” and 1.6% “Poor.” Poor means the lowest applicable deck, superstructure, substructure, or culvert rating is 4 or below on the 0–9 NBI scale. It is a condition category, not a live safety or closure decision.
Responsible agencies inspect covered bridges on risk-based intervals under current NBIS rules and submit inventory data to FHWA annually. The list below shows every NBI-tracked bridge in the county. That is 0.2% of the county's reported daily bridge traffic on 1.6% of its bridges: Poor-condition structures carry less traffic than their share of the inventory. Each Poor bridge averages 207 crossings a day against 2,384 for a Good-condition one. A Poor rating is a condition category, not a closure or a live safety judgement; it means the lowest applicable component rating is 4 or below.
Computed over the 185 of 185 bridges in this county that report an average daily traffic count. Source: FHWA National Bridge Inventory, 2024 release.
39 of the 185 bridges with a recorded construction year were built in 1974 or earlier. Age alone is not a defect: a well-maintained older bridge can rate Good, and 48.6% of this county's inventory does. Even so, this older cohort is the population from which future Poor ratings are drawn, which is why the age profile below matters alongside the condition split above.
Cutoff derives from the 2024 release year minus a 50-year design life. Source: FHWA National Bridge Inventory, 2024 release.
SOUTH RIVER RD over MINNOW CREEK, built 1993, carries 350 vehicles a day, the most of any Poor-rated structure here. The county's Poor-condition exposure is concentrated rather than evenly spread, so the 3-bridge count understates how much of the daily burden sits on a single crossing.
Share is of the 620 daily crossings on Poor-rated bridges that report a traffic count. Source: FHWA National Bridge Inventory, 2024 release.

What this shows Construction peaked in the 1980s, when 38 of the county's bridges still in the inventory were built, which is 20.5% of those with a recorded year. That cohort is now 35 to 44 years old in the 2024 inventory. Its average build year is 1988, 10 years newer than the Indiana average of 1978.
The 5 Indiana counties nearest Cass County in number of bridges, with their condition splits. Its 1.6% Poor share is the 2nd-lowest of these 6. Its average build year of 1988 against a peer-group mean of 1980 is 8 years newer.
